Output 7a009e256d24b539873d2887e638c524a6103085a9ac0494fbda990b3eb91402:0

value
12718701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9da605c2e6045410f240dee3489a714fc9690ed OP_EQUAL
address
3HB7j2DfyZqk4k7XAmkGByFJDoyuKeJeKV
transaction
7a009e256d24b539873d2887e638c524a6103085a9ac0494fbda990b3eb91402
confirmations
101514
spent
true